Graduate Student Assembly - 140

Purpose: 1) Conduct activities which promote the general welfare of graduate students; 2) facilitate graduate student communication and inter- action; 3) gather and disseminate information pertinent to graduate students; 4) to represent the views of graduate students to the University community and the community at large; and 5) provide effective representation to appropriate bodies relating to graduate students.

Membership: Each representative must be a UT graduate student in good standing and working toward a degree in the area he/she represents. Students, faculty, and staff at The University of Texas at Austin.

Functions: 1) Distribution and compilation of Graduate Guide; 2) Who's Who selection; 3) production of special seminars on topics of interest to graduate students; 4) investigation of graduate students' areas of concern; 5) graduate orientation co-sponsor. MAI 2403 G2000

Organization Type: Student Government
